How To Overcome Challenges During Development Of iOS Apps?


There are 6.3 Billion smartphone users in the world. Arrived in the digital age, companies that focus on technology spread all over the world because of the use of the iPhone often. More and more companies are investing in the development of the operating system iOS applications to take advantage of the growing demand. And many organizations rely on the development of iOS applications to get a piece of cake. Thanks to the success of many applications iOS, as a source of inspiration.

It is, however, easier said than done. In the development and design of the application iOS to promote and distribute it to the store, developers’ iOS applications face many obstacles. First of all, you need to choose the best mobile app development platform. This will lessen so many development obstacles. In this article, we'll look at some of the most common problems that iOS app developers experience. Let's take a closer look at each one individually.

Best Ways to Overcome Challenges during the Development of iOS Apps

Here are the best ways that help you overcome app development challenges:

Maintain application performance in low bandwidth environments

It will be difficult to integrate and play video files, and other services live with inadequate access to the network. Using these high-definition media a lot of data. Your Internet connection users may be different. As a result, it is very important to get the iOS application to pass the test link air network. It helps iOS simulator networks that do not live up to the required level of developers.

Compatibility of iOS applications

Although the iPhone is Apple's biggest popular product today, we must also address other Apple devices and tools when developing mobile iOS applications. Developers should keep in mind that consumers who buy iPhone laptops may also own, and the software must be compatible with both. Moreover, upgrade only 60% of the iPhone owners to the latest version of the recent iOS.

This means that different versions of the internal control circuit are installed on different iPhone devices. Each of these difficulties provides services to the development of the iOS application and must ensure compatibility across different sizes and screen versions of the operating system.

Approvals in Store

It is available for download on the Apple Store for more than two million applications. This number is minor compared with the number of applications that have been rejected for inclusion in this prominent application market Application approval at Apple is subject to strict rules. This leads to a simple violation of the sovereignty of many applications to be rejected. What is worse for the iPhone application development companies is that Apple amending these guidelines regularly to protect the safety of their tools.

In light of this, iOS application development services need to be fully conversant with Apple's standards, and the most recent revisions to be to minimize the chance of rejection after spending a lot of time and money on the application. While the development of iOS mobile applications is fun, developers must work hard to stay current with new developments and methods to provide reliable mobility solutions.

The development of multiple applications and hardware platforms for mobile devices

It may require many companies to develop applications for a variety of devices, including iPad, iPhone, Android, and Windows phones and tablet devices and computers that are running Windows, Linux, or Apple, in addition to many operating systems across devices. 

In such circumstances, they must operate mobile device applications that they create consistently across all of these platforms and devices. 

Beta Testing

The launch of the Apple application dramatically approaches depending on the beta test. It enables developers to test iPhone applications before they are released in the App Store. Examines tester's trial versions of application functionality and are looking for defects, errors and defective structure, and other concerns. Before the application version, iPhone developers can identify potential failures and the collection of user inputs and eliminate or correct problems.

UI / UX / User Experience Design

Preferably the majority of users of iOS applications because of the larger user experience and approach to design clean. When you create an iPhone application, developers must take into account the end-user. To build a process flow that is easy to use, you must make sure that the user interface includes only the required elements and functions.

To create an interactive interface and intuitive, designers must consider the latest design, such as flat and material trends and homogeneous during the creation of UI / UX for one application.

An application running on multiple platforms

There is a group of people who do not use only smartphones and also use multiple operating systems such as Windows, Mac, and Linux. Target population applications that can be synchronized across computers, computers, mobile phones, and tablet devices, allowing them to use the application from any device in their spare time.

Future-proofing app

It's a challenge to create future-proof iOS apps. To create such applications, developers must be aware of Apple's planned innovations in advance. This is a little unpredictable business. However, skilled iOS developers may gain insight into the upcoming iOS version release by studying and thinking about Apple's product line.

Maintain a clear approach

Another problem for developers is to make the mobile application easy and understandable to users. This can be achieved by designing a simple structure and adding quick tutorials and instructions, as we discussed earlier in our guide to overcoming app development issues.


An iOS application built can never be a success unless the following issues are adequately dealt with. Many companies have failed simply because they were unable to solve issues and offer something unique to their target market. While developing iOS mobile apps is fun, developers must work hard to stay current with new developments and methods in order to provide a reliable navigation solution. So, you need to be very patient and up-to-date while developing an iOS app.

Previous Post Next Post